What Affects HVAC Cost in Atherton
Atherton installations are the most premium residential HVAC projects in the Bay Area. Estate homes (5,000–15,000+ sq ft) require multiple independent HVAC systems or highly sophisticated multi-zone configurations, often with dedicated systems for main residences, guest houses, and pool pavilions. Premium, ultra-quiet equipment is the only option considered. Extended refrigerant line runs across multi-acre lots, specialized equipment placement on manicured properties, and coordination with landscape architects and general contractors all contribute to comprehensive project scope.

Atherton HVAC Installation Considerations
Atherton's one-acre minimum lot sizes and mature oak and redwood canopy create property-specific microclimates that require custom load calculations — shade patterns, wind exposure, and building orientation vary dramatically across each estate. The town's architectural review requires that all outdoor equipment be completely screened from any public or neighboring view. Atherton's exclusivity means virtually zero commercial noise, making equipment sound specifications the most stringent we encounter anywhere in the Bay Area. The town's proximity to Menlo Park and Palo Alto means Peninsula Clean Energy's competitive electricity rates benefit Atherton's larger systems, though operating costs are secondary to performance and comfort in this market.

Atherton Climate
Atherton has a mild Peninsula climate with warm summers in the low 80s and cool winters. The town's tree canopy and large lot sizes create pleasant microclimates within individual properties.
